Has anyone done back to back Disney Adventures trips? Next year we are thinking of doing Knights and Lights and one of the Italy tours (Viva Italia or Rome and La Costa Bella.) It would either be Knights and Lights from 9.25-10.2 followed by Rome and La Costa Bella from 10.2-10.8 (adult only tour) OR Viva Italia from 8.28-9.5 followed by Knights and Lights from 9.5-9.12. On the first trip option I could add a pre-night or two on to London so we may be able to see Stonehenge. On the second trip I could book a post night or two to see Disneyland Paris. Do you think we would make the start of the second tours ok? When do most people arrive for the start of the tours? When is breakfast over the last day? Also, how far is Pompeii from Rome? Are there any good tour places from Rome to Pompeii if I booked a pre-night or two (day trip?) Thanks for any input!

I can't answer from personal experience, but there was a family on our Knights and Lights tour that did the Ireland tour right before ours. They even had one of the same guides!

They had fun on both tours and didn't seem too tired from tour overload!
 
We also had a couple on our tour who had just finished the "Spain" tour, then flew from Barcelona to Rome. They didn't seem to have a problem, either. They felt it was worth it... "since they were already over there."

Only problem they had was with ABD booking their air.... due to contractural issues - ABD was unable to book their transfer from Barcelona to Rome, as I recall.
